Quick verdict

Bowmore 25 Year Old is rated higher (5.00 vs 4.80).

Bowmore 25 Year Old is better value at £403 vs £599.

For beginners: Balvenie 17 Year Old Madeira Cask is more approachable (70/100 beginner score).
